]> granicus.if.org Git - clang/commit
Better implementation of JavaScript === and !== operators.
authorAlexander Kornienko <alexfh@google.com>
Thu, 21 Nov 2013 12:43:57 +0000 (12:43 +0000)
committerAlexander Kornienko <alexfh@google.com>
Thu, 21 Nov 2013 12:43:57 +0000 (12:43 +0000)
commitce33deef7e5c22617d039d4d9f7bd18d5e50b2e4
tree8712f9d5c558e6c6806958dbfd4ae93834632330
parent4e42f6ad343790c6f9873e13c8e205adc13373d9
Better implementation of JavaScript === and !== operators.

Summary:
Now based on token merging. Now they are not only prevented from being
split, but are actually formatted as comparison operators.

Reviewers: djasper, klimek

Reviewed By: klimek

CC: cfe-commits, klimek
Differential Revision: http://llvm-reviews.chandlerc.com/D2240

git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@195354 91177308-0d34-0410-b5e6-96231b3b80d8
lib/Format/Format.cpp
lib/Format/TokenAnnotator.cpp
unittests/Format/FormatTest.cpp